My Background and Approach
I’m a drug and alcohol counselor with experience supporting clients in both outpatient and intensive outpatient settings. In these spaces, I’ve had the privilege of walking alongside people at different stages of recovery—from those just starting out to those working on long-term change. My background includes facilitating groups, guiding clients through the 12-steps, and using CBT skills to help shift negative thought patterns. These approaches allow clients to build practical coping strategies, gain new perspectives, and feel more in control of their recovery. I also specialize in working with clients from diverse cultural backgrounds and offer services in both English and Kurmanji (Kurdish), ensuring support is accessible and stigma doesn’t stand in the way of healing. My focus is always on creating a safe, compassionate environment where clients feel understood and empowered to move forward.
